Marine Le Pen, her father and 26 other people are put on trial. All will be tried in the fall of 2024 for embezzlement of public funds. They are suspected of having employed, with European funds, collaborators who actually worked for the National Front.

Marine Le Pen, Jean-Marie Le Pen and Louis Aliot, as well as 24 other people, were referred to the criminal court next fall. The Paris prosecutor’s office suspects the party leadership at the time of having put in place, between 2004 and 2016, a system of remuneration by the European Union for assistants to MEPs who actually worked for the National Front. Accusations denied outright by a press release.

6.8 million euros in damage

The investigation began in March 2015 following a report from the European Parliament to French justice. After several refusals to appear before the judges, Marine Le Pen was indicted in 2017 for breach of trust and complicity, facts ultimately reclassified as embezzlement of public funds. It is a matter that sticks to the skin of the National Rally, without seeming to weaken it. Civil party in this case, the European Parliament estimates its damage at 6.8 million euros.
